Bitcoin & Blockchain: Legal and Ethical Issues You Need to Know to Help Clients
17 April 2018
Of Counsel Peter Vogel and associate Edward H. Block will present “Bitcoin & Blockchain: Legal and Ethical Issues You Need to Know to Help Clients,” a TexasBarCLE webcast available at 12:30 p.m. April 17.
This presentation will explain legal and technical details about blockchain so lawyers will be better prepared to help their clients. Specifically, lawyers need to understand internet business transactions using blockchain and the related privacy and tax concerns. The ethical considerations about blockchain that will be discussed include how protecting attorney-client privilege may be affected.
